POV-Ray教程:开启3D渲染之旅
POV-Ray教程:开启3D渲染之旅
POV-Ray(Persistence of Vision Raytracer)是一款免费的、开源的3D渲染软件,深受图形设计师、动画师和爱好者的喜爱。今天,我们将为大家详细介绍POV-Ray教程,帮助你快速上手并掌握这款强大的工具。
POV-Ray简介
POV-Ray的全称是Persistence of Vision Raytracer,它通过模拟光线追踪技术来生成高质量的3D图像。它的特点在于其高度的灵活性和精确的渲染效果。无论你是想创建逼真的风景、复杂的机械模型,还是艺术性的抽象图形,POV-Ray都能满足你的需求。
为什么选择POV-Ray?
- 开源与免费:POV-Ray是完全免费的,并且其源代码开放,任何人都可以参与开发和改进。
- 高质量渲染:POV-Ray支持复杂的光线追踪算法,能够生成非常逼真的图像。
- 脚本语言:使用POV-Ray语言编写场景文件,灵活性极高,可以实现各种复杂的效果。
- 跨平台:支持Windows、Mac OS、Linux等多种操作系统。
POV-Ray教程内容
POV-Ray教程通常包括以下几个部分:
-
基础入门:
- 安装POV-Ray
- 了解POV-Ray的基本语法
- 创建简单的几何图形(如球体、立方体、圆柱体等)
-
场景构建:
- 如何定义相机和光源
- 材质和纹理的应用
- 场景布局和对象的放置
-
高级技巧:
- 光线追踪的优化
- 动画制作
- 特殊效果(如大气效果、反射、折射等)
-
实战案例:
- 室内设计渲染
- 外观设计与产品展示
- 科幻场景和特效制作
POV-Ray的应用
POV-Ray在多个领域都有广泛应用:
- 艺术创作:许多艺术家使用POV-Ray来创作抽象艺术或逼真的风景画。
- 教育:在计算机图形学课程中,POV-Ray常被用作教学工具,帮助学生理解光线追踪原理。
- 科学可视化:用于模拟和展示复杂的科学数据,如分子结构、天文现象等。
- 游戏开发:虽然不是主要用途,但POV-Ray可以用于生成游戏中的静态场景或特效。
- 建筑与设计:建筑师和设计师利用POV-Ray进行建筑模型的渲染和展示。
学习资源
学习POV-Ray的资源非常丰富:
- 官方文档:POV-Ray的官方网站提供了详细的文档和教程。
- 社区支持:有活跃的用户社区,可以在论坛中找到各种问题解答和分享。
- 在线教程:YouTube上有许多由用户制作的教学视频,涵盖从基础到高级的各种内容。
- 书籍:虽然不多,但有几本专门介绍POV-Ray的书籍,适合深入学习。
结语
POV-Ray作为一款经典的3D渲染工具,其强大的功能和灵活性使其在众多领域中都有着不可替代的地位。通过本文的POV-Ray教程,希望能激发你的兴趣,引导你进入3D渲染的世界。无论你是初学者还是专业人士,POV-Ray都能为你提供一个广阔的创作空间。记得多实践,多尝试,相信你一定能创作出令人惊叹的作品!